Christian Keime | Foucault Reading Plato: does the Symposium provide evidence for a history of sexuality?
Mar 2, 2023 @ 11:00 am - 12:30 pm
Bunche Hall 4276,
![](https://classics.ucla.edu/wp-content/uploads/2023/02/053DFE16-2F99-4B42-813E-C3C9E09F33C2.jpeg)
Professor Christian Keime (Classics, University of Cambridge) gives a public lecture, part of the CMRS-CEGS Research Seminar for Winter 2023, “Historicity. Re-reading Michel Foucault,” taught by UCLA Professor Giulia Sissa.
